[0117] figure 1 An analytical instrument 100 according to the invention is shown. The analytical instrument 100 includes a reagent rotor 102 and a loading device 104 . The loading device 104 is adapted to load the reagent rotor 102 with reagent containers 106 . The loading device 120 includes a tray 108 adapted to receive a plurality of reagent containers 106 . The tray 108 is formed as a segment of a ring. The tray 108 includes a compartment 110 for receiving the plurality of reagent containers 106 . For example, tray 108 includes five compartments for receiving five reagent containers 106 . Abstract

A loading device (104) for loading a reagent rotor (102) of an analytical instrument (100) with reagent containers (106) is disclosed. The loading device (104) comprises: a tray (108) adapted to receive a plurality of reagent containers (106), wherein the tray (108) can be positioned in a first plane (112) at least in a loading position (114) and moving between an unloading position (116) where the tray (108) can be loaded with the plurality of reagent containers (106) and where the The plurality of reagent containers (106) can be unloaded from the tray (108), and a reagent rotor for transporting the plurality of reagent containers (106) from the tray (108) to the analytical instrument (100) (102) The conveying device (124), wherein said tray (108) is formed such that said conveying device (124) can be in a second plane (126) from said unloading position ( 116) linearly moving to said reagent rotor (102) and / or from said reagent rotor (102) to said unloading position (116) of said tray (108), wherein said first plane (112 ) and the second plane (126) are different from each other, wherein the tray (108) is formed as a segment of a ring.

Description

technical field [0001] The invention relates to a loading device for loading reagent containers of a reagent rotor of an analytical instrument, and to an analytical instrument. Background technique [0002] An analytical instrument in the sense of the present invention, and more particularly a medical analytical instrument, for the examination of body fluids, especially blood, or any other reagent used in the medical field. Such modern analytical instruments are mostly fully automatic in operation and only the samples stored in the reagent containers need to be inserted into the analytical instrument and have to be entered for the desired analysis. [0003] The invention is intended for analytical instruments operating with liquid reagents contained in reagent containers which may be made of plastic.
